AI-driven detection of early Alzheimer’s through eye screenings

USask spearheads cutting-edge research. SASKATOON — University of Saskatchewan (USask) researchers Dr. Changiz Taghibiglou (PhD) and Dr. Sara Mardanisamani (PhD) are bridging biology and data science to develop a new, non-invasive AI screening tool for those at risk for Alzheimer’s disease.
